Resembling the tail of a cat or fox, the Asparagus densiflorus 'Myersii' is an adorable ornamental plant that has needle-like leaves that can be prickly to touch.
Sunlight: Place your Asparagus densiflorus 'Myersii' under bright and filtered sunlight, and do avoid direct sunlight as it will scorch its leaves and dry up. Place your plant near a window and make sure it receives filtered sunlight.
Water: Allow the top surface of the soil to dry up between watering the plant. We recommend watering it once a week or whenever necessary. Overwatering your plant can cause water beds, and this will result in root problems. Above all, pair your plant with a well-draining potting mix to avoid soggy soil and root rot.
Fertiliser: Feed your plant with a water-soluble fertiliser at half strength once a month.
